### Account Recovery — Catalogue Import (Lintwood)

Quick one for review: when the Lintwood catalogue import wipes a patron's session table, the recovery flow re-seeds accounts from the nightly snapshot. Check that the importer skips locked accounts — last time it didn't. To rerun recovery against staging you'll need the vault passphrase, which is appended just below.

recovery phrase for yafof-tajof: julmir-kelax-julvan-holath-belvan-holir-ralael-ralvan-ralath-julvan-silmir-istmir-kaswyn-ulamir

MEMO — Kettling Depot Receiving

Uniform sets for the new Kettling depot arrive Wednesday via Ashgrove courier: 40 boxes, sorted by size, manifest attached to box one. Check the count at the dock before signing; shortages go straight to stores, not the courier. The hand-over instruction the courier will follow is set out below.

drop instructions, tafof-baguf: the holmir gilox courier leaves the sormir ulaok holdor ledger at gate 5596 under passcode 257343

Welcome aboard — Quillstone Partners

Quick note for contractors: candidate interviews happen in the Harrow Room on Level 3, which stays locked for privacy. Book it through the floor assistant, grab the folder of consent forms from the shelf inside, and leave the blinds as you found them. To get in, punch in the door code below.

staff pass of kawip-hawef = bdg-QLP-2

Document Transport — Print Shop Master Copies

Quick guide for moving master copies to Bramblehurst Print Co. These are the only originals, so treat the run like a valuables transfer, not a regular parcel drop. Use the red tamper-evident envelopes from the supply shelf, log the seal number in the transport book, and never combine the run with general mail. The masters go directly to the press supervisor, nobody else. On arrival, the courier must follow the hand-over instruction stated below.

drop instructions, kajep-tageg: the kasvan casdor courier leaves the quenvan quenox druox ledger at gate 4316 under passcode 799004